Course Content

• Aquaponics System Design and Construction: This unit covers the fundamental principles of designing and building efficient and sustainable aquaponic systems, including plant selection and media choices.
• Aquatic Biology for Aquaponics: This unit focuses on the biology of fish commonly used in aquaponics, water quality parameters, and the crucial role of beneficial bacteria (Nitrosomonas and Nitrobacter) in the nitrogen cycle.
• Aquaponic Wastewater Treatment & Water Quality Management: This explores effective water quality monitoring techniques, wastewater treatment strategies, and the prevention of common aquaponics problems.
• Plant Nutrition in Aquaponic Systems: This unit details the nutritional needs of various crops grown in aquaponic systems and how to optimize nutrient delivery via fish waste recycling.
• Integrated Pest Management in Aquaponics: This unit covers the identification, prevention, and control of common pests and diseases affecting both fish and plants in aquaponic systems, including biological control methods.
• Sustainable Aquaponics Practices: This module explores environmentally friendly techniques and the long-term sustainability of aquaponics, minimizing environmental impact.
• Aquaponics Troubleshooting and System Maintenance: This unit covers practical skills in diagnosing and resolving common problems in aquaponic systems, including troubleshooting equipment malfunctions.
• Aquaponics Business and Marketing: This unit covers the business aspects of aquaponics, including developing a business plan, marketing strategies, and economic considerations.
